Output c5393f4b42ebe8a8c9a958b7fab620712f553d5345db6ea3e7d72e39107453f6:3

value
668823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168ea534efbd4a0ee9339972e2f3b6032c6c9aa4 OP_EQUAL
address
33kHfwEj2yobcYCyLBHumddGbMjkPMbNAL
transaction
c5393f4b42ebe8a8c9a958b7fab620712f553d5345db6ea3e7d72e39107453f6
spent
true